Solid Copper Tenor Saxophone Neck at KDI MUSIC

Solid Copper Tenor Saxophone NeckThe Rheuben Allen Professional Solid Copper Tenor Saxophone neck with the 2-Point Soldered Heavy Freedom/Power Neck Brace with Adjustable Sound Weight System is designed to improve the performance of any Tenor Saxophone.

The design of the neck brace removes a large amount of solder from the bottom of the neck. This is a necessary design feature on all traditional neck braces.

*Due to the inconsistency and hand work during the manufacturing of saxophones… it is almost always necessary to fit a new neck to your instrument.

**All Custom Tenor Saxophone Necks must be custom fitted to your Tenor Saxophone by a Professional Woodwind Repair Person. Once the neck is adjusted to fit your Tenor Saxophone, it is not returnable.
